Reuse, Repurpose, Recycle: Artificial Turf Fields

Artificial turf is incredibly eco-friendly compared to pesticide-dependent, water-guzzling natural grass. Artificial turf spares billions of gallons of water and millions of pounds of fertilizers and pesticides from being applied to the soil of natural grass fields every year, while preventing hundreds of thousands of pounds of carbon from being spewed from grass care equipment into the atmosphere.

Even the highest quality, most durable artificial turf fields will reach the end of their useful life after a decade or two. So what happens to artificial turf once it reaches the end of its useful life? Are there options available to avoid the landō¸°€ill and disposal costs?

After decades of trying to come up with a solution to these questions, the answer is now a resounding yes! In this new era of artificial turf, new and innovative removal methods allow an artificial turf field’s materials to be reused, repurposed, and even recycled.

Reusing Artificial Turf

During the past 10 years, reused artificial turf has become a popular option for residential and municipal landscapes, roof gardens, pet parks, playgrounds, and other landscape and recreation applications.

Repurposing Artificial Turf

Repurposed artificial turf is cleaned, repaired, and commonly used in batting cages, dugouts, indoor practice facilities, driving ranges, sand trap lining for erosion control, sidelines, and running track protective strips.

Recycling Artificial Turf

Recycling artificial turf involves the conversion of its many components into usable materials. After the artificial turf has been separated, it is converted into raw materials that can be used to make new products.
